본문 바로가기
카테고리 없음

도지코인 스마트 계약 만들기: 초보자를 위한 가이드

by 비노비 2025. 7. 17.

 

💡 도지코인의 가격 변동을 분석하고 투자 전략을 수립하는 방법을 알아보세요. 💡

 

지금 도지코인 배우세요

도지코인 스마트 계약 만들기를 배우는 것은 블록체인 기술의 기초를 이해하는 데 도움이 됩니다. 이 가이드는 초보자도 쉽게 따라 할 수 있는 단계별 과정을 제공합니다. 도지코인을 활용하면, 더욱 창의적인 프로젝트를 개발할 수 있는 기회를 얻게 됩니다.

도지코인 기반의 스마트 계약은 안전하고 효율적인 거래를 가능하게 합니다. 또한, 도지코인의 활성 커뮤니티와 다양한 자원이 여러분의 학습을 지원합니다.

주요 특징

도지코인 스마트 계약은 몇 가지 주요 특징이 있습니다:

  • 빠른 거래 속도
  • 낮은 거래 수수료
  • 유연한 개발 환경

비교 분석

도지코인 vs. 기타 암호화폐

암호화폐 거래 속도 거래 수수료
도지코인 1분 미만 매우 낮음
비트코인 10분 이상 상대적으로 높음
이더리움 내부 네트워크 상황에 따라 다름 상대적으로 높음

이 표는 도지코인과 다른 인기 암호화폐 간의 주요 차이점을 보여줍니다. 특히 도지코인은 거래 속도와 수수료 면에서 우수한 특징을 가지고 있습니다.

 

💡 도지코인 스마트 계약의 매력을 알아보세요. 💡

 

스마트 계약을 이해하세요

도지코인 스마트 계약 만들기를 시작하기 전에 꼭 알아야 할 것이 바로 스마트 계약의 기본 개념이에요. 여러분, 스마트 계약이 무엇인지 혹시 들어보셨나요?

나의 경험

가장 처음의 혼란

  • 처음에 나는 스마트 계약이 너무 복잡해 보였어요.
  • 친구가 도지코인을 사용해서 자동으로 기부가 이루어지는 예시를 듣고 흥미가 생겼죠.
  • 이 모든 것이 프로그래밍과 관련이 있어 보였지만, 이해가 잘 되지 않았어요.

스마트 계약의 핵심

그런데 가볍게 생각해보면, 스마트 계약은 단순히 블록체인에서의 계약이예요. 이 계약은 자동으로 실행되는 코드라고 할 수 있어요. 예를 들어, A가 B에게 도지코인을 보내는 계약을 설정하면, 조건이 맞춰지면 자동으로 발송이 이루어지는 거죠.

이해를 돕기 위해 몇 가지 주요 포인트를 정리해볼게요:

  1. 스마트 계약은 조건이 충족되면 자동으로 실행됩니다.
  2. 트랜잭션 기록이 블록체인에 남아 변조할 수 없습니다.
  3. 중개자 없이 신뢰할 수 있는 계약 체결이 가능합니다.

자, 이제 여러분은 스마트 계약의 기본을 이해하셨죠? 도지코인 스마트 계약 만들기를 시작하기 전에 이 개념을 충분히 꿰뚫어 보셔야 해요. 어떻게 생각하시나요? 혹시 궁금한 점이 있으신가요?

 

💡 영도구 유기견 보호소에 대한 모든 정보를 쉽게 찾아보세요. 💡

 

필수 도구를 준비하세요

도지코인 스마트 계약 만들기를 위한 준비가 필수적입니다. 아래의 필수 도구를 통해 성공적인 스마트 계약 개발을 도와드립니다.

준비 단계

첫 번째 단계: 도구 설치하기

도지코인 스마트 계약 개발을 시작하려면 Node.jsnpm을 먼저 설치해야 합니다. Node.js 공식 사이트에 방문하여 운영체제에 맞는 설치 파일을 다운로드하고 설치하세요.

개발 환경 설정

두 번째 단계: 개발 환경 만들기

설치가 완료되면, 터미널을 열고 작업할 폴더를 생성합니다. mkdir dogecoin-smart-contract 명령어를 사용하여 폴더를 만들고, cd dogecoin-smart-contract로 이동합니다. 이제 해당 폴더에 필요한 패키지를 설치할 수 있습니다.

패키지 설치하기

세 번째 단계: 필수 패키지 설치하기

스마트 계약 개발에 필요한 패키지를 설치합니다. 다음 명령어를 입력하세요: npm init -y로 package.json 파일을 생성하고, npm install web3를 통해 Web3.js 라이브러리를 설치합니다. 이 라이브러리를 통해 도지코인 블록체인과 상호작용할 수 있습니다.

확인 및 주의사항

네 번째 단계: 환경 점검하기

모든 도구가 제대로 설치되었는지 확인하기 위해, 다음 명령어를 실행합니다: node -vnpm -v. 각 버전이 표시되면 성공적으로 설치된 것입니다.

주의사항

각 단계에서 오류가 발생할 경우, 인터넷에서 해당 오류 메시지를 검색해 해결 방법을 찾아보세요. 환경 변수 설정이 필요할 수 있으므로, 설치 가이드를 면밀히 따라야 합니다.

 

💡 경기도 성남시 인테리어필름 업체에 대한 모든 정보가 여기 있습니다. 💡

 

첫 계약을 작성해보세요

많은 초보자들이 도지코인 스마트 계약을 만드는 과정에서 어려움을 겪습니다. 어떤 언어로 작성해야 할지, 어디서 시작해야 할지 막막할 수 있습니다.

문제 분석

사용자 경험

"저는 도지코인으로 스마트 계약을 만들고 싶었지만, 시작하는 데 엄청난 두려움이 있었습니다." - 사용자 C씨

이 문제의 원인은 도지코인의 생태계와 스마트 계약의 개념을 잘 모르기 때문입니다. 특히, 적절한 도구와 리소스가 부족해 초보자들은 복잡하게 느낄 수 있습니다.

해결책 제안

해결 방안

해결 방법으로는 도지코인의 공식 문서와 기존의 예제 코드를 참고하는 것입니다. 특히, GitHub에 있는 오픈 소스 프로젝트를 활용하면 학습 속도를 높일 수 있습니다. 예를 들어, 아래 코드 스니펫은 간단한 계약을 작성하는 출발점이 될 수 있습니다:

contract SimpleContract {
    uint public value;
        function setValue(uint _value) public {
                value = _value;
                    }
                    }
                    
"이러한 코드 예제를 통해 빠르게 이해할 수 있었습니다. 전문가 D씨는 '기본 원리를 이해하는 것이 중요하다'고 강조합니다."

따라서, 이러한 접근법을 통해 첫 스마트 계약을 단계별로 작성하는 것은 가능합니다. 여러분의 첫걸음을 응원합니다!

 

💡 도지코인을 활용한 스마트 계약의 이점과 방법을 알아보세요. 💡

 

결과를 확인하고 개선하세요

도지코인 스마트 계약 만들기 과정에서 다양한 결과를 접하게 됩니다. 각각의 결과를 점검하고 개선하는 과정은 매우 중요합니다.

다양한 관점

첫 번째 관점

첫 번째 관점에서는 결과를 주기적으로 점검하는 것이 필수적이라고 봅니다. 이는 코드에 버그가 없는지, 기대한 기능이 제대로 작동하는지를 확인하는 데 도움이 됩니다. 이 방법은 발견된 오류를 신속히 수정할 수 있어 장점이 큽니다.

두 번째 관점

반면, 두 번째 관점에서는 결과 확인을 정기적인 피드백의 일환으로 보는 것이 중요하다고 주장합니다. 이 방법은 사용자들의 의견을 적극적으로 반영하여 더욱 완성도 높은 스마트 계약을 만들어 갈 수 있도록 합니다. 그러나 단점은 피드백이 늘 긍정적이지 않다는 점입니다.

결론 및 제안

종합 분석

종합적으로 볼 때, 두 관점 모두 각자의 장단점이 있습니다. 코드 점검과 사용자 피드백 모두 스마트 계약을 개선하는 데 필요한 요소들입니다. 상황에 따라 어떤 방법을 선택할지는 개발자의 상황과 목표에 크게 달려 있습니다.

결론적으로, 가장 중요한 것은 자신의 개발 환경과 필요에 맞는 방법을 선택하여 도지코인 스마트 계약 만들기에서 최상의 결과를 얻는 것입니다.